Stap 2: De elektronica
Ik maakte mijn sensoren met 5 SMD IR emiting dioden, 5 SMD fototransistoren en 5 1 k SMD weerstanden. Tussen de fototransistor en de IR zet ik sommige zwarte siliconen zodat de IR licht niet rechtstreeks naar de fototransistor zou komen. Het PCB-design is in het archief "lijn follower.rar". Het is gemaakt in PROTEUS, maar ik heb een word-document, met inbegrip van alle de PCB ontwerpen die kunnen worden gedrukt op glanzend papier of pers en Peel, en vervolgens overgebracht naar de PCB met behulp van de methode van het strijkijzer.
Als u niet wilt maken van uw eigen sensor kunt u kopen vanaf hier: http://www.robotshop.com/pololu-qtr-infrared-sensor-array-1.html .
De MICROCONTROLLER PCB:
Het "hart" van deze robot is een ATMEGA8 microcontroller de informatie van de sensoren krijgt en de motorcontroller L293D rijden.
Onderdelenlijst:
1 x 28-pins aansluiting (voor ATMEGA8)
1 x 14-pins aansluiting (voor L293)
1 x ATMEGA8-u kunt ook een ATMEGA 168 of 328. Het programma is gemaakt in de Arduino , zodat hebt u een arduino, u kunt program van de microcontroller, dan het verwijderen van arduino en plaatst u deze in dit PCB. Ook kun je via de 6 pinnen bij een ISP microcontroller programmeren. U kunt kopen een 328 ATMEGA om te programmeren op uw arduino vanaf hier: http://www.robotshop.com/sfe-atmega328-with-arduino-bootloader.html
1 x L293D
1 x 16 MHz kristal
2 x 22pF (10-28pF)
1 x LM7805 http://www.robotshop.com/lm78m05-voltage-regulator.html
1 x drukknop http://www.robotshop.com/sfe-12mm-push-button-switch.html
1 x 100nF
1 x 100uF
1 x 4.7 uF
6 x LEDs
1 x 1K Ohm weerstand
1 x 33R weerstand
1 x weg breken-Header http://www.robotshop.com/sfe-straight-pin-headers.html
1 x rechte vrouwelijke kop http://www.robotshop.com/straight-female-headers.html
1 x schakelaar
Draden
Ook moet u een 4 AA-batterijhouder.
Alles wat u nodig hebt voor het maken van de microcontroller pcb en de sensoren PCB is in het archief "lijn follower.rar". Hier vindt u het PCB-design, en de schema's die zijn gemaakt in Proteus, maar zijn ook beschikbaar in het Word-document.
Nu alles wat je hoeft te doen is nemen de soldeerbout en beginnen om te solderen van alle onderdelen.
Nadat u ' ve gemonteerd de robot, moet u de microcontroller te programmeren. Het programma is gemaakt is van Arduino, zodat u kunt naar de Arduino uploaden en dan de microcontroller in dit "motherboard zet". Je hebt ook het HEX bestand voor een ATMEGA8 met behulp van 16Mhz kristal.